Common Causes of Semi-Tire Flats

The most frequent culprits behind a flat tire semi situation involve external damage and internal wear. Punctures from sharp objects like nails or glass are common. Sidewall impacts with curbs or debris can cause tears that lead to leaks. Overloading the vehicle stresses tires beyond their rated capacity, increasing heat and the risk of failure. Additionally, improper inflation – both under and over – compromises tire integrity and promotes uneven wear, which can eventually lead to a flat.

Regular inspections are not optional; they are fundamental. A driver should check tire pressure and look for visible damage before and after long hauls. This proactive approach is the best defense against unexpected roadside emergencies.

Signs of a Developing Flat Tire

Detecting a semi-truck flat tire in its early stages can save considerable trouble and expense. Drivers must remain vigilant for subtle changes in vehicle performance or auditory cues. Ignoring these signals is a costly mistake that can escalate minor issues into major roadside breakdowns.

The most apparent sign is a noticeable change in how the truck handles. You might experience pulling to one side, especially during braking or turning. A sudden, loud pop followed by immediate handling difficulties is usually indicative of a catastrophic tire failure, often referred to as a blowout. This demands an immediate, safe pull-over.

Beyond handling, auditory cues are critical. A distinct hissing sound suggests a slow leak from a puncture or a faulty valve stem. Sometimes, a flapping noise from a tire could mean the tread is separating or the tire is severely deflated and beginning to disintegrate. Such sounds require immediate investigation.

Perform a quick walk-around inspection after hearing any unusual tire noise; a single tire that appears significantly lower than the others warrants immediate attention before pulling over.

Monitoring tire pressure gauges, if equipped, is also a primary defense. A rapidly dropping pressure reading is a clear warning. Visual checks should focus on the tread for unusual wear patterns, embedded objects, or signs of bulging on the sidewall, which indicates internal damage that could lead to a flat tire semi event.
